ludo <at> gnu.org (Ludovic Courtès) skribis:

> "Cook, Malcolm" <MEC <at> stowers.org> skribis:

[...]

>> In guix/cve.scm:
>>   76: 2 [call-with-cve-port # 518400 ...]
>> In guix/http-client.scm:
>>  300: 1 [http-fetch/cached # # 518400 ...]
>> In unknown file:
>>    ?: 0 [string-append #f "/http/" "Fjb931UJRoTPOjHq6hc1oawK9bCopdhOoX9grKLx71Q="]
>>
>> ERROR: In procedure string-append:
>> ERROR: In procedure string-append: Wrong type (expecting string): #f'
>
> This is a harmless failure: it indicates that neither the HOME nor the
> XDG_CACHE_HOME environment variables are defined in the build
> environment.

Commit dd1d09f7e4c522d2185eda9c806ea525e10172be should avoid this
situation.
